Какое представляют JavaScript-Object-Notation плюс Extensible-Markup-Language

JavaScript-Object-Notation плюс XML образуют собой стандарты пересылки информацией, которые применяются с-целью передачи сведений для разными системами. Эти-форматы применяются во web-разработке, интеграции сервисов, взаимодействии с API-интерфейсами и хранении организованных данных. Ключевая функция указанных форматов проявляется через следующем, чтобы создать удобный и унифицированный метод передачи информации.

В-рамках электронной инфраструктуре информация необходимо отправляться среди приложениями плюс серверами, и еще между различными программами. Во прикладных сценариях а-также аналитических материалах, включая 7k casino официальный сайт, часто показывается, каким-образом JavaScript-Object-Notation а-также XML задействуются для настройки передачи сведениями, согласования данных и обмена среди платформами.

Каков такое JavaScript-Object-Notation

JavaScript-Object-Notation, либо JS Object Notation, представляет по-сути легковесный формат информации, базирующийся на-основе модели структур а-также массивов. Он использует 7к казино текстовый способ, он удобно читается а-также анализируется как пользователем, так-же а-также системами. JSON часто применяется в онлайн-сервисах а-также API-интерфейсах.

Сведения в JSON представлены во формате пар ключ-значение. Ключ обозначает собой имя элемента, и значение способно выступать текстом, числом, логическим типом, набором или вложенным объектом. Данная схема создает этот-формат практичным с-целью размещения плюс пересылки сведений.

JavaScript-Object-Notation выделяется лаконичностью а-также простотой. JSON не предполагает трудных правил оформления, из-за-этого его удобнее задействовать при работе со иными форматами. Это делает его популярным вариантом онлайн казино ради современных приложений.

Какое такое Extensible-Markup-Language

XML, либо Extensible разметочный Language, представляет по-сути формат структурирования, он задействуется для хранения а-также отправки сведений. Он построен на применении элементов, что обозначают организацию информации. Extensible-Markup-Language позволяет создавать индивидуальные элементы плюс задавать их содержимое.

Информация внутри XML заключаются внутрь разметочные-теги, они имеют открывающую и финальную часть. Такая структура создает XML более строгим а-также строгим. Extensible-Markup-Language используется для разных платформах, где нужна четкое представление схемы данных 7к.

XML отличается гибкостью а-также гибкостью. Данный-формат дает-возможность формировать многоуровневые структуры плюс применять атрибуты для конкретизации параметров. Это делает формат подходящим для сценариев, где необходима строгая схема данных.

Основные различия JSON-формата плюс XML-формата

JavaScript-Object-Notation а-также XML реализуют схожую роль, но используют отличающиеся подходы для передаче информации. JSON использует более простой формат плюс меньшее-число служебных-элементов, данный-фактор создает формат легковесным. Extensible-Markup-Language предполагает увеличенное-число разметочных частей, что повышает массу информации.

JSON удобнее разбирается плюс оперативнее интерпретируется для многих современных систем. Extensible-Markup-Language, во свою сторону, обеспечивает расширенные средств для описания организации а-также контроля информации. Выбор 7к казино для JSON-и-XML определяется с-учетом задач отдельной системы.

Дополнительно различается механизм работы с сведениями. JSON чаще используется во онлайн-сервисах и интерфейсах-API, в-то-время как XML-формат применяется во бизнес системах, технических-файлах а-также передаче упорядоченной данными.

Структура JSON

JSON-формат состоит на-основе структур плюс списков. Структура обозначает собой комплект связок key-value, помещенных в служебные символы. Набор формирует собой список значений, помещенных во square brackets.

Отдельное значение во JavaScript-Object-Notation имеет-возможность быть элементарным а-также многоуровневым. Элементарные онлайн казино данные охватывают символы, числовые-значения а-также булевы типы. Многоуровневые значения охватывают наборы а-также вложенные структуры. Такая организация помогает передавать многоуровневые информацию.

JSON не содержит комментарии и жесткую типизацию, это ускоряет JSON применение. Тем-не-менее это предполагает аккуратности во-время обработке со данными, с-целью избежать неточностей.

Организация Extensible-Markup-Language

XML-формат задействует древовидную организацию, построенную вокруг внутренних разметочных-блоках. Отдельный элемент получает обозначение плюс способен 7к включать информацию или другие элементы. Это помогает формировать многоуровневые модели данных.

Теги XML-формата имеют-возможность включать дополнительные-свойства, которые дополняют данные. Дополнительные-свойства записываются на-уровне открывающего элемента и создают вспомогательный слой уточнения.

Extensible-Markup-Language предполагает жесткого выполнения условий оформления. Каждые элементы обязаны быть завершены, и организация обязана быть корректной. Данный-фактор делает данный-стандарт значительно строгим, но обеспечивает стабильность информации.

Применение JavaScript-Object-Notation

JSON активно применяется во онлайн-сервисах. JSON 7к казино применяется с-целью отправки информации между пользовательской-частью и backend, а еще с-целью работы через интерфейсами-API. Благодаря данной понятности он считается базой в современных системах.

JSON-формат используется во mobile системах, системах анализа а-также интеграции платформ. Данный-формат позволяет быстро передавать информацию и интерпретировать сведения без трудных преобразований.

Дополнительно JSON задействуется ради размещения параметров и параметров. Его организация создает JSON подходящим ради описания значений и данных последующего онлайн казино использования.

Использование XML-формата

Extensible-Markup-Language применяется для решениях, где нужна строгая структура данных. Он используется для корпоративных решениях, пересылке данными а-также интеграции нескольких систем.

XML-формат часто используется в стандартах пересылки данными, таких как системные документы, документы плюс отчеты. Данный-формат расширяемость дает-возможность подстраивать структуру под-задачи конкретные задачи.

Дополнительно XML-формат используется в системах, где критична валидация сведений. Существуют служебные схемы, они дают-возможность контролировать корректность структуры плюс содержимого.

Плюсы а-также ограничения

JSON-формат обладает совокупность преимуществ, среди-которых легкость, компактность и скорость обработки. Данный-формат удобен для программистов плюс хорошо используется с-целью современных приложений. При-этом 7к JSON возможности описания организации менее-широкие.

XML обеспечивает более расширенные средства ради контроля информации. Он включает описания, атрибуты плюс формальную схему. Данный-фактор создает XML пригодным ради сложных платформ, но увеличивает размер информации и нагрузку обработки.

Подбор между JavaScript-Object-Notation и XML зависит на-основе требований. Когда требуется скорость а-также легкость, обычно используется JSON. Если необходима четкая организация а-также проверка сведений, задействуется XML.

Преобразование JSON и Extensible-Markup-Language

Ради работы через JSON и Extensible-Markup-Language используются отдельные инструменты и пакеты. Такие-инструменты дают-возможность читать, записывать плюс преобразовывать данные. В основной-части языков программирования доступна встроенная совместимость этих 7к казино структур.

Разбор JSON-формата как-правило эффективнее, поскольку как его организация проще. XML требует увеличенного-объема мощностей вследствие развитой структуры плюс нужды валидации тегов.

Перевод информации среди форматами также допустимо. Данный-подход дает-возможность интегрировать платформы, задействующие разные структуры. Подобные операции часто запускаются самостоятельно посредством применением профильных библиотек онлайн казино.

Значение JSON и XML для актуальных платформах

JSON плюс Extensible-Markup-Language являются ключевыми компонентами электронной среды. Данные-стандарты обеспечивают пересылку информацией между платформами плюс дают-возможность создавать подключения. В-случае-отсутствия указанных стандартов связь между сервисами становилось-бы бы значительно менее-удобным.

JSON-формат является основным форматом с-целью онлайн-сервисов и API благодаря собственной легкости и быстроте. XML удерживает собственную актуальность во системах, в-которых требуется формальная структура и контроль информации.

Оба стандарта по-прежнему использоваться плюс эволюционировать. Данные-форматы остаются важными средствами с-целью отправки информации а-также создания цифровых 7к платформ.

Расширенные особенности структур

JSON плюс XML-формат выделяются не-исключительно только структурой, но плюс подходом для обработке через информацией. JSON-формат обычно задействуется в-роли формат обмена, при-этом как XML может применяться в-роли с-целью отправки, так-же и с-целью размещения сведений. Такая-особенность соотносится с тем-фактом, что Extensible-Markup-Language дает-возможность описывать более развитые структуры а-также условия проверки.

Во JSON нет поддержка заметок, это создает формат намного лаконичным с-точки-зрения стороны оценки структуры. Внутри XML-формате 7к казино пояснения разрешаются, что ускоряет документирование сведений. Однако это еще расширяет объем плюс имеет-возможность затруднять анализ.

Дополнительно важной чертой является чувствительность относительно case. Внутри JSON-формате названия зависимы ко case, это требует контроля при обработке. Во XML дополнительно важно учитывать корректное обозначение элементов, поскольку потому-что сбой в обозначении способна повлечь для некорректной обработке.

Скорость и оптимальность

JSON чаще-всего обрабатывается быстрее, поскольку как JSON структура лаконичнее а-также требует меньшего-объема вычислений. Это онлайн казино особенно значимо в-условиях обработке с значительными массивами информации плюс высокими нагрузками. JavaScript-Object-Notation обычно задействуется для решениях, когда критична оперативность отклика.

XML-формат требует значительно-больше вычислений с-целью обработки, поскольку потому-что требуется проверять схему элементов и валидировать элементов правильность. При-этом данная-особенность уравновешивается возможностью строгой контроля сведений а-также гибкостью организации.

Во-время определении формата критично учитывать условия системы. Если приоритетом считается оперативность плюс малый-объем, как-правило используется JavaScript-Object-Notation. Когда критична структурированность плюс проверка сведений, выбирается 7к Extensible-Markup-Language.